#a70976 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a70976 is composed of 65.5% red, 3.5%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94.6% magenta, 29.3%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 318.6 degrees, a saturation of 89.8% and a lightness of 34.5%. #a70976 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ff12ec with #4f0000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

Shades and Tints of #a70976

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#12010d is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#a70976

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d535a is the less saturated color, while #ae0279 is the most saturated one.
